The Psychology of Color in Artistic Posters and Workspace Design

Colors have a profound effect on our mood and cognitive function, making art selection vital for any office. High-quality artistic posters featuring blues and greens can promote calmness, while reds and yellows can stimulate energy and focus. Choosing the right palette for your workspace ensures that your environment supports the specific type of work you perform daily.

Lighting Your Art for Maximum Impact

Proper lighting is essential to showcase the true colors and details of your posters within an office setting. Avoid harsh glares by using indirect lighting or specialized picture lights that highlight the artwork without washing out the colors. Good lighting ensures that your office feels warm and inviting, rather than cold and clinical, throughout the working day.
